Engine Fire - Single Engine

Immediate actions · 6 steps

  1. 1
    Throttle (affected)OFF
  2. 2
    Engine Fire T-HandlePULL
  3. 3
    Fuel Shutoff (affected)OFF
  4. 4
    If fire persistsCONSIDER EJECTION
  5. 5
    Single-engine airspeed200+ kts
  6. 6
    Land immediatelynearest suitable runway

Dual Engine Flameout

Immediate actions · 6 steps

  1. 1
    Airspeed250 kts (optimal windmill)
  2. 2
    AltitudeTRADE for airspeed
  3. 3
    ThrottlesOFF, then IDLE
  4. 4
    Engine CrankATTEMPT relight
  5. 5
    If no relight below 10,000 ftEJECT
  6. 6
    Squawk 7700MAYDAY call

Hydraulic Failure

Immediate actions · 6 steps

  1. 1
    HYD PRESS warningCHECK combined pressure
  2. 2
    HYD Transfer PumpNORMAL
  3. 3
    If single systemreduced control authority
  4. 4
    If dual failureEMERGENCY flight controls only
  5. 5
    Reduce airspeed250 kts max
  6. 6
    Land immediatelyfly straight-in approach

Compressor Stall

Immediate actions · 6 steps

  1. 1
    Throttle (affected)IDLE
  2. 2
    If stall clearsslowly advance throttle
  3. 3
    If stall persistsThrottle OFF
  4. 4
    Engine Fire T-HandleCHECK (no fire)
  5. 5
    Single-engine landing if required
  6. 6
    Do not attempt AB on stalled engine
